Paul Simon wrote:
> I've been using a tool called ABouncer (recommended by someone on
> this NG) to notify ISP's when I receive Unsolicited Bulk E-mail.
>
> I started wondering whether this tool is actually working properly,
> so I tried sending mail from my web-mail address to ordinary address,
> then used ABouncer to bounce it back to my web address.
>
> This has not worked, so does that mean ABouncer is'nt sending any
> messages to ISP's, or am I misunderstanding something.
>
> Incidentally, when I click SEND on ABouncer, after a few seconds it
> flashes up Caught Sendmail ....... I've always assumed that meant
> that the message had been sucessful.

So are you the mail admin of the domain from which you sent the test
message? Probably not. So why are you expecting to get the abuse alert
message? It goes to abuse@<domain>, NOT to the sender (which would be
worthless when a spammer). Do you have access to the abuse@<domain>
e-mail account to see the bounce?

I don't know ABouncer but there would be no point to having it
bounceback an abuse alert to the spammer (i.e., sender). It needs to go
to the abuse department of the domain that sent it.
